Sonic the Hedgehog 2 arrived on Blu-ray on August 9, 2022, featuring high-definition video, a Dolby Atmos audio track, and over an hour of bonus content, including an animated short, deleted scenes, and bloopers. | Feature | Standard Blu-ray | 4K Ultra HD Blu-ray | | :--- | :--- | :--- | | Resolution | 1080p | Native 2160p (4K) | | HDR | No | Dolby Vision + HDR10 | | Audio | DTS-HD MA 5.1 | Dolby Atmos (object-based) | | Discs | 1 BD + 1 DVD + Digital | 1 UHD + 1 BD + Digital | | Price (MSRP) | $29.99 | $44.99 |
Verdict: If you have a 4K TV and a Dolby Atmos soundbar or receiver, the 4K edition is non-negotiable. The Atmos track puts you inside the snowmobile chase—snow crunching below, Robotnik’s drones whizzing overhead. Let’s get technical. I tested the 4K disc on an LG C2 OLED and a 7.1.2 Atmos system. The HDR grading is a revelation. The opening scene on the mushroom planet goes from inky black caverns to radioactive neon pink spores without any crush or clipping. Knuckles’ red fur has a velvet texture that streaming masks with macroblocking.
The Dolby Atmos mix is aggressive. During the final battle, the overhead channels carry debris from the collapsing temple, and the subwoofer delivers a chest-thump every time Robotnik’s mech stomps. The score by Tom Holkenborg (Junkie XL) breathes—synth bass pulses in the rear surrounds while the main melody stays front-and-center.
